Output b58c61dec1b7c1deceff74b418a5803d08c2e27d29a346ba9629027bccb0e286:0

value
105556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1fb314dbd3d0615dc856f5c639ba445a86929c7 OP_EQUAL
address
3PkVgwbkwX24BTthFhbLazscWsRXKvpgMF
transaction
b58c61dec1b7c1deceff74b418a5803d08c2e27d29a346ba9629027bccb0e286
confirmations
295848
spent
true